Motion · S3M-07024 · 20 Sep 2010
Supporting Epilepsy Specialist Nurses
The motion
That the Parliament welcomes Epilepsy Action’s report, Best Care: the value of epilepsy specialist nurses; supports Epilepsy Action’s campaign to preserve epilepsy specialist nurse (ESN) posts and welcomes the campaigning activity of Epilepsy Scotland, Quarriers and other organisations; believes that ESNs make an invaluable contribution to patient care; considers that ESNs save costs by reducing demand on consultants’ time, reducing hospital admissions and reducing emergency readmissions; understands that there is an increasing threat to ESNs of redundancy, reduced working hours or assignment to non-specialist duties as NHS boards seek short-term cost savings, and believes that the Scottish Government must ensure that there is a strategic plan to enable all patients across Scotland assessed as requiring access to an ESN to have that access.
